Transaction 5543c69b9402693ac0f524aefa4f22d6c7764f66a5cfa19d0b63a150f7a63d54
1 Input
1 Output
-
5543c69b9402693ac0f524aefa4f22d6c7764f66a5cfa19d0b63a150f7a63d54:0
- value
- 22513
- script pubkey
- OP_0 OP_PUSHBYTES_20 d407b3e1d17977de98dbb405c3c74b77456ac589
- address
- bc1q6srm8cw309maaxxmkszu836twazk43vfqju67f